Expert Review
The role of a delivery driver with Uber Eats offers significant flexibility, allowing individuals to choose their working hours. This is particularly appealing for those balancing other commitments, such as school or family responsibilities. Drivers can earn money on their schedule, which is a key attraction for many.
Earnings can vary widely based on location and time of day. While some drivers report making a decent hourly wage, others may find their earnings inconsistent, especially during slower periods. drivers are responsible for their vehicle expenses, which can cut into profits.
this opportunity, the lack of employee benefits is to keep in mind. Drivers are classified as independent contractors, meaning they won't receive health insurance or paid time off. This setup works well for some, but it might not be suitable for individuals seeking a stable income with benefits.
As competition increases in popular areas, it can also become more challenging to secure delivery requests. This aspect may lead to frustration during peak hours, as drivers compete for limited orders. Understanding these dynamics is essential before committing to this gig.
